NORTH NORWAY — Donald David Clark, 50, of North Norway passed away on Thursday, March 31, at his family homestead, “Sunnyside Farm,” surrounded by his beloved family.
Donald was born March 2, 1966, in Norway and was a 1984 graduate of Oxford Hills High School with a certification in forestry management.
Most of his career was spent using his passion and talents as a carpenter. He was a longtime employee of Damon Brothers Building Contractors of Mechanic Falls and later at Sabre Yachts in Casco, as a finish carpenter.
Donald loved history and land preservation exemplified in the purchase and restoration of his own home. Donald was a very kind, loving and ethical soul with quiet wit and humor. He will be greatly missed.
Donald is survived by his mother, Marilyn Johnson Clark of North Norway; sisters, Melissa C. Sulloway of Bridgton, Shelly Stevens of Norway, Belinda Clark of Norway; brothers, Russell E. Clark Jr. of Greenwood and Joel Clark of Norway; and 10 nieces and nephews; and four great-nieces and nephews.
Donald was predeceased by his father, Russell E. Clark Sr.
